This season has seen the highest salt production in Bangladesh in the last 62 years.
Bangladesh Small and Cottage Industries Corporation (BSCIC) said in a press release on Wednesday that the total production of salt in the current season has stood at 1,839,000 tons. If the weather is favourable, it will be possible to produce more than two million tons of salt.
Last year, the highest record of salt production was 1,832,000 tons.
The BSCIC said a total of 10,930 tons of salt was produced in a day on Tuesday.
The total cultivated land in the current salt season is 66,424 acres, which was 63,291 acres last year. Compared to last year, this year salt farming land has increased by 3,133 acres.
In the current salt season, the number of salt farmers is 39,467, which was 37,231 last year. Compared to last year, the number of salt farmers has increased by 2,236 people.
BSCIC said that since 1961, salt production started in a planned manner in the country through BCIC.
At present, all the upazilas of Cox's Bazar district and Chittagong's Banshkhali are being provided with training, credit and technology extension to farmers for salt cultivation through 12 salt centres under the jurisdiction of BCIC's salt industry development program office located in Cox's Bazar.
With the aim of achieving self-sufficiency by producing salt in the country without importing it, salt farmers are brought to the field a month before the current salt season. The first production of the last salt season started on November 30.
The current salt season production started on October 24, 2022. Short term (1 year), medium term (1-5 years) and long term (above 5 years) action plans have been adopted to achieve self-sufficiency in salt production.
Encouraging and training salt cultivators in advanced salt cultivation in modern methods as per time-bound action plan, identification and expansion of new areas for salt cultivation, loans to salt farmers on easy terms, increasing salt yield per acre, allotment to actual salt cultivators, determining the lease value of salt farming land, conservation of salt farming land, demonstration of modern methods of salt production and providing technical assistance in quality control of produced salt, conducting surveys, electricity connection and salt production in salt farming areas, and regular monitoring activities are being conducted to control stock and price.
